Transaction d75e83ecc613a15ba699f24a1e1f71f232716f0a3f994d7a7d9d81b0d1fa16ab

100 Input
1 Outputs
  • d75e83ecc613a15ba699f24a1e1f71f232716f0a3f994d7a7d9d81b0d1fa16ab:0
  • value  306810257
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h